He hadn't planned for any of this. All he'd wanted to do was get both of them out of the hotel, away from the press and Yakov or anyone else, before the shock had worn off. And now he's having to figure things out, right on the spot, like being in the middle of a flagging performance and knowing that your only hope is to let the momentum of a spin or the glide out of a landing buy you enough time to determine how to make up the difference.
'You don't need to talk to them just to be polite.' Yuri pushes a strand of hair out of his eyes. 'Tell them if you want anything, if there's something wrong with your skates or you need tape or a bandage or anything like that. But they won't bother you if you don't want to be bothered, and it won't offend them if you don't ask them for help. Yakov wouldn't get in the way of anything that someone else's coach has had them do.'
The tea might have helped the tension in his shoulders, but only enough to let it move to his chest, strained like a rubber band pulled too far. It's that tension as much as anything else that makes him glance away then, and mutter:
'Anyway, I'm the one who screwed up today. So they've got other things to think about than what you're doing.'
He can still feel the impact from that stupid triple axel at the start. Hitting the ice right off the bat, like he'd never landed it a thousand times before. All because the agape wasn't there.
